引言

随着互联网技术的飞速发展,HTML5作为一种新兴的网页技术,已经在电子商务领域得到了广泛应用。HTML5的引入为商城网站的建设带来了前所未有的机遇和挑战。本文将深入探讨HTML5在商城网站建设中的应用,揭秘高效商城网站建设的秘诀。

HTML5重构的意义

  1. 提升用户体验:HTML5提供了丰富的交互性和多媒体功能,可以提升商城网站的用户体验,使浏览更加流畅和有趣。
  2. 优化网站性能:HTML5的离线存储、本地数据库等功能可以减少服务器请求,提高网站加载速度。
  3. 跨平台兼容性:HTML5具有良好的跨平台兼容性,可以确保商城网站在不同设备上都能正常访问。
  4. 增强SEO效果:HTML5的语义化标签有助于搜索引擎更好地解析网站内容,提高搜索引擎优化(SEO)效果。

高效商城网站建设的秘诀

1. 优化页面结构

  • 语义化标签:使用HTML5的语义化标签,如<header><nav><section><article><aside>等,使页面结构更加清晰。
  • 响应式设计:采用响应式布局,使商城网站能够适应不同屏幕尺寸的设备,提供更好的用户体验。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>商城网站</title>
    <style>
        /* 响应式设计样式 */
        @media screen and (max-width: 600px) {
            .container {
                width: 100%;
            }
        }
    </style>
</head>
<body>
    <header>
        <nav>
            <!-- 导航栏 -->
        </nav>
    </header>
    <section>
        <article>
            <!-- 商品展示 -->
        </article>
        <aside>
            <!-- 侧边栏 -->
        </aside>
    </section>
    <footer>
        <!-- 页脚 -->
    </footer>
</body>
</html>

2. 丰富交互体验

  • 动画效果:利用CSS3和JavaScript实现页面动画效果,提升页面视觉冲击力。
  • 表单验证:通过HTML5的表单验证功能,确保用户输入数据的准确性。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
    <meta charset="UTF-8">
    <title>表单验证</title>
    <style>
        /* 表单验证样式 */
        .error {
            color: red;
        }
    </style>
</head>
<body>
    <form>
        <input type="text" name="username" required pattern="[a-zA-Z0-9]{6,}" title="用户名必须是6-12位字母或数字">
        <span class="error" id="error_username"></span>
        <br>
        <input type="email" name="email" required>
        <br>
        <input type="submit" value="提交">
    </form>
    <script>
        // 表单验证脚本
        document.querySelector('form').addEventListener('submit', function(event) {
            var username = document.querySelector('input[name="username"]');
            var email = document.querySelector('input[name="email"]');
            if (!username.value.match(/^[a-zA-Z0-9]{6,}$/)) {
                document.getElementById('error_username').textContent = '用户名格式不正确';
                event.preventDefault();
            }
        });
    </script>
</body>
</html>

3. 优化性能

  • 图片优化:对商城网站中的图片进行压缩,减少图片大小,提高加载速度。
  • 缓存策略:利用浏览器缓存,减少服务器请求次数,提高网站访问速度。
// JavaScript缓存策略示例
var cache = {};
function loadImage(url) {
    if (cache[url]) {
        var img = new Image();
        img.src = cache[url];
        return img;
    } else {
        var img = new Image();
        img.onload = function() {
            cache[url] = img.src;
        };
        img.src = url;
        return img;
    }
}

4. 提高SEO效果

  • 搜索引擎友好:使用HTML5的语义化标签,优化网站结构,提高搜索引擎对网站内容的识别度。
  • 内容优化:优化商城网站的内容,提高关键词密度,提升网站在搜索引擎中的排名。

总结

HTML5重构为商城网站建设带来了许多机遇,通过优化页面结构、丰富交互体验、优化性能和提高SEO效果,可以打造出高效、用户体验良好的商城网站。在实际开发过程中,应根据项目需求灵活运用HTML5技术,为用户带来更好的购物体验。